Craigie on Main

 Craigie on Main

Craigie on Main in Cambridge

About Craigie on Main

853 Main Street
Central Square
(617) 497-5511

Craigie on Main takes a different approach to food.

The menu is ever-changing. The chefs find the freshest ingredients of the the day and then prepare the meals based on what they find, rather than the other way around.

The restaurant is a big supporter of environmentally friendly practices, and it uses an extensive amount of organic ingredients on the menu.

Craigie goes great lengths to create their dishes, and the quality of food they provide speaks for itself. It’s a favorite and we highly recommend it.

[pw_map address=”853 Main Street, Cambridge, MA 02139″]